Abstract

This study focuses on the barriers to implementing supply chain management (SCM) 4.0 in the foundry industry and provides insights into its practical implementation in foundry units. Our study identifies barriers such as data privacy, legal issues, SCM complexity, and barriers related to implementing Industry 4.0 (I4.0)-enabled SCM in the foundry industry. It also provides insights into the role of digital infrastructure in building effective I4.0-enabled SCM. This study provides insights into how SCM 4.0 can be implemented in the foundry industry. The findings will be helpful to policymakers and foundry consultants in designing appropriate strategies for foundry units.
